A Tail-Wagging Deadline! Secure Your Dogs License Now

Reminder to purchase a dog license before the January 31 deadline

 

CUYAHOGA COUNTY, OH – The Cuyahoga County Animal Shelter reminds all Ohio dog owners that the deadline to purchase a required dog license is Wednesday, January 31, 2024. The cost of a one-year dog license is $20. Dog licenses must be current for the calendar year. Licenses can be purchased for terms of one or three years and can also be purchased for the lifetime of the dog.

The State of Ohio requires that all dogs aged three months and older have a current dog license. Licenses purchased after the deadline are assessed an additional $20 fee, per Ohio law, doubling the price of a one-year license. Dog owners are encouraged to buy now and avoid the penalty fees.

Lost dogs can be reunited with their legal owner more easily when wearing a dog license. A dog license also allows for longer stray hold times (up to 14 days instead of 72 hours), should the dog enter a shelter.

Dog licenses can be purchased for terms of one or three years, or for the lifetime of the dog:

  • a one-year tag is $20,
  • a three-year tag is $60,
  • a lifetime tag is $200.

Cuyahoga County residents can buy their dog licenses at local Discount Drug Mart locations or Pet Supply Plus stores, at the Cuyahoga County Animal Shelter, or online.

Fees from dog licenses support the Cuyahoga County Animal Shelter and the lost and stray dogs it houses until reunited with their owners or adopted to new homes.
